Why Long-Range Cruising Requires a Different Engine Mindset
Long-range cruising exposes weaknesses that never show up near shore.
An engine that performs beautifully for short runs may fail when asked to:
- run at steady load for hundreds of hours
- push a fully loaded displacement hull
- operate in varying fuel quality conditions
- remain serviceable without specialized tools

Understanding Continuous-Duty Ratings (What Vendors Actually Watch)
One of the most overlooked specs in engine selection is continuous-duty capability.
Engines built primarily for intermittent use:
- run hotter under sustained load
- consume more fuel when pushed continuously
- show wear sooner
Engines designed for continuous duty:
- are often conservatively rated
- operate comfortably below maximum output
- last significantly longer in real cruising conditions

Power Explained: How Much Is Enough—and When It’s Too Much
Power should support the boat, not dominate the decision.
In long-range cruising, excessive horsepower often creates more problems than it solves:
- engines run underloaded
- combustion efficiency drops
- long-term reliability suffers
From real-world installations we’ve supported, the most successful setups share one thing: the engine operates comfortably at 60–75% load at cruising speed.
This keeps:
- fuel burn stable
- internal temperatures controlled
- wear patterns predictable
Torque vs Horsepower in Long-Range Cruising
Torque is what moves a loaded boat through water efficiently.
High-torque engines:
- push displacement hulls with less throttle
- reduce stress on gearboxes and drivetrains
- allow smoother operation in adverse conditions
This is why many commercial-grade or derated marine diesel engines outperform higher-horsepower recreational models in long-range cruising scenarios.

Design Choices That Affect Fuel Consumption
From vendor data and customer feedback, fuel efficiency is strongly influenced by:
- Engine tuning for mid-range RPM
- Conservative boost pressures
- Injection system simplicity
- Propeller and gearbox matching
Over-engineered systems may look advanced but can increase consumption when operated outside ideal conditions. Simpler designs often deliver more consistent real-world efficiency.
Reliability Offshore: What Actually Keeps You Moving
Reliability is not the absence of failure—it’s predictability and recoverability.
Engines trusted by long-range cruisers share several traits:
- proven block designs with long service histories
- global parts availability
- straightforward maintenance access
- conservative thermal management

Why Simplicity Often Wins in Remote Cruising
Electronic control systems can be excellent—but they demand:
- clean fuel
- diagnostic tools
- trained technicians
Many long-range cruisers choose mechanical or lightly electronic systems because they:
- tolerate variable fuel quality
- can be serviced manually
- fail more transparently
Neither approach is “wrong,” but matching system complexity to cruising plans is essential.

Installation and Support: The Hidden Reliability Factors
Even the best engine can fail if installed poorly.
Critical installation considerations include:
- cooling flow design
- exhaust routing
- gearbox compatibility
- vibration isolation
We’ve seen reliability issues traced not to the engine itself, but to overlooked installation details. That’s why experienced vendors treat installation guidance as part of the engine selection process—not an afterthought.

How long should a properly selected marine diesel engine last?
With correct loading and maintenance, 10,000–20,000 hours is common in cruising applications.
Is higher horsepower safer offshore?
Not necessarily. Proper loading and efficiency matter more than peak output.
Are electronic engines risky for long cruising?
They can be excellent, but they require cleaner fuel and diagnostic access.
Is buying new worth the cost?
For long-range cruising, predictability and warranty coverage often justify the investment.
